เปรียบเทียบเอกสารจาก Stream - GroupDocs.Comparison สำหรับ .NET

การแนะนำ

ในโลกปัจจุบันที่มีการเปลี่ยนแปลงอย่างรวดเร็ว ข้อมูลมีมากมายและมีการเปลี่ยนแปลงอยู่ตลอดเวลา การรับรองความถูกต้องและความสอดคล้องกันของเอกสารจึงถือเป็นสิ่งสำคัญที่สุด ไม่ว่าคุณจะอยู่ในสาขากฎหมาย ภาคการเงิน หรืออุตสาหกรรมอื่นใดที่ความสมบูรณ์ของเอกสารเป็นสิ่งสำคัญ GroupDocs.Comparison สำหรับ .NET นำเสนอโซลูชันที่แข็งแกร่งเพื่อปรับปรุงกระบวนการเปรียบเทียบให้มีประสิทธิภาพ

ข้อกำหนดเบื้องต้น

ก่อนที่จะเริ่มใช้ GroupDocs.Comparison สำหรับ .NET มีข้อกำหนดเบื้องต้นบางประการที่คุณต้องมี:

  1. ติดตั้ง .NET Framework: ตรวจสอบให้แน่ใจว่าคุณได้ติดตั้ง .NET Framework ไว้ในระบบของคุณแล้ว คุณสามารถดาวน์โหลดได้จากเว็บไซต์ของ Microsoft
  2. ดาวน์โหลด GroupDocs.Comparison สำหรับ .NET: เยี่ยมชม ลิงค์ดาวน์โหลด เพื่อรับ GroupDocs.Comparison เวอร์ชันล่าสุดสำหรับ .NET
  3. เอกสารประกอบการเข้าถึง: ทำความคุ้นเคยกับฟังก์ชันการทำงานของห้องสมุดโดยอ้างอิงจาก เอกสารประกอบ.
  4. ความเข้าใจพื้นฐานเกี่ยวกับ C#: บทช่วยสอนนี้ถือว่าคุณมีความเข้าใจพื้นฐานเกี่ยวกับภาษาการเขียนโปรแกรม C#

นำเข้าเนมสเปซ

ก่อนที่จะเริ่มต้นการเปรียบเทียบเอกสารโดยใช้ GroupDocs.Comparison สำหรับ .NET คุณต้องนำเข้าเนมสเปซที่จำเป็นลงในโปรเจ็กต์ของคุณ:

using System;
using System.IO;

ตอนนี้คุณได้ตั้งค่าข้อกำหนดเบื้องต้นและนำเข้าเนมสเปซที่จำเป็นแล้ว มาแบ่งกระบวนการเปรียบเทียบเอกสารออกเป็นหลายขั้นตอน:

ขั้นตอนที่ 1: กำหนดไดเรกทอรีเอาต์พุตและชื่อไฟล์

ขั้นแรก ระบุไดเรกทอรีที่คุณต้องการบันทึกเอกสารที่เปรียบเทียบและชื่อไฟล์เอาท์พุต:

string outputDirectory = "Your Document Directory";
string outputFileName = Path.Combine(outputDirectory, "RESULT.docx");

ขั้นตอนที่ 2: เริ่มต้นวัตถุ Comparer

ถัดไป ให้สร้างอินสแตนซ์ของ Comparer คลาสโดยส่งเอกสารต้นฉบับเป็นพารามิเตอร์:

using (Comparer comparer = new Comparer(File.OpenRead("SOURCE.docx")))

ขั้นตอนที่ 3: เพิ่มเอกสารเป้าหมาย

เพิ่มเอกสารที่คุณต้องการเปรียบเทียบกับเอกสารต้นฉบับโดยใช้ Add วิธี:

comparer.Add(File.OpenRead("TARGET.docx"));

ขั้นตอนที่ 4: ดำเนินการเปรียบเทียบ

ดำเนินการเปรียบเทียบโดยเรียกใช้ Compare วิธีการและการระบุไฟล์เอาท์พุต:

comparer.Compare(File.Create(outputFileName));

ขั้นตอนที่ 5: แสดงข้อความยืนยัน

ในที่สุดแสดงข้อความยืนยันการเปรียบเทียบสำเร็จและตำแหน่งของไฟล์เอาท์พุต:

Console.WriteLine($"\nDocuments compared successfully.\nCheck output in {outputDirectory}.");

บทสรุป

GroupDocs.Comparison สำหรับ .NET ช่วยลดความยุ่งยากของงานเปรียบเทียบเอกสาร ช่วยให้ผู้ใช้สามารถระบุความแตกต่างได้อย่างง่ายดายและรับรองความสมบูรณ์ของเอกสาร คุณสามารถผสานรวมความสามารถในการเปรียบเทียบเอกสารเข้ากับแอปพลิเคชัน .NET ได้อย่างราบรื่นโดยทำตามขั้นตอนที่ระบุไว้ในบทช่วยสอนนี้

คำถามที่พบบ่อย

GroupDocs.Comparison สำหรับ .NET สามารถเปรียบเทียบเอกสารที่มีรูปแบบต่างกันได้หรือไม่

ใช่ GroupDocs.Comparison สำหรับ .NET รองรับการเปรียบเทียบเอกสารในรูปแบบต่างๆ เช่น DOCX, PDF, PPTX และอื่นๆ

มี GroupDocs.Comparison สำหรับ .NET ให้ทดลองใช้งานฟรีหรือไม่

ใช่ คุณสามารถใช้ประโยชน์จากการทดลองใช้ GroupDocs.Comparison สำหรับ .NET ฟรีได้โดยเข้าไปที่ เว็บไซต์.

ฉันสามารถปรับแต่งการตั้งค่าการเปรียบเทียบได้หรือไม่

อย่างแน่นอน GroupDocs.Comparison สำหรับ .NET นำเสนอตัวเลือกการปรับแต่งมากมายเพื่อปรับแต่งกระบวนการเปรียบเทียบตามความต้องการของคุณ

GroupDocs.Comparison สำหรับ .NET รองรับการเข้ารหัสเอกสารหรือไม่

ใช่ ห้องสมุดรองรับการเปรียบเทียบเอกสารเข้ารหัสขณะที่รักษาความปลอดภัยของข้อมูล

ฉันสามารถขอความช่วยเหลือหรือสนับสนุนเกี่ยวกับ GroupDocs.Comparison สำหรับ .NET ได้จากที่ใด

คุณสามารถเยี่ยมชม ฟอรั่มสนับสนุน อุทิศให้กับ GroupDocs.Comparison สำหรับ .NET เพื่อขอความช่วยเหลือจากชุมชนหรือส่งคำถามของคุณ